This week in the #wednesdaywellbeing show I'll be chatting with internationally certified Personal Trainer Sam Blakey. Sam is the owner of Oobermama.   She built up a successful boutique fitness company, Ooberfit, shortly after qualifying as a PT in 2012, whilst living with her family in Singapore,.   Prior to returning to the UK, she had built up a reputation as the foremost pre and post natal coach there and her company was voted Best Fitness Provider in Singapore two years in succession, by a national magazine.  On returning to the UK in 2017, she settled in Harrogate and spotting a gap in the market, decided to focus on her pre and post natal specialisms.   As well as a woman’s health coach, she is a Certified Pilates Instructor and one of only nine senior trainers with UKHypopressives.   Hypopressives is a unique core-restoring, low pressure breathing technique that helps clients safely reconnect the all important core muscles.  With five children of her own, Sam fully understands the toll giving birth has on mums and credits working alongside women’s health physios in Singapore as invaluable in ensuring she could give these mums the most appropriate pre and post-natal workouts.  Sam also works with women with more severe rehab issues, such as abdominal separation, prolapse, bladder incontinence and poor posture, using Hypopressives to great effect.   “When I moved back to the UK, I decided to primarily focus on training women and particularly pre and post-natal fitness, drawing on the experience I had gained working alongside women’s health physios and from leading Mums & Tums, Pilates, HIIT and Boxing FIT classes over the past six years. I love helping to give women a leg-up on their journey to fitness through carefully designed fitness programmes, videos and - as a former journalist - informative blogs.”  This week I'll also be talking with Laura Hellfeld, a nurse consultant, sleep practitioner, children's yoga teacher and the founder of koko pie families.   Her organisation supports the mental wellbeing of parents and caregivers. She specifically specialises in working with neuro divergent children and children who have experienced trauma.   Her work reaches a multitude of families and children who are looking for new ways to better connect and communicate within the family.   She teachers strategies that encourage and lift up children.
